Subject: [PATCH] nvme-cli/fabrics: Add tos param to connect cmd
Date: Sun, 18 Aug 2019 12:08:50 +0300	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1566119335-15058-2-git-send-email-israelr@mellanox.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1566119335-15058-1-git-send-email-israelr@mellanox.com>

Added 'tos' to 'connect' command so users can specify the type of service.

usage examples:
nvme connect --tos=0 --transport=rdma --traddr=10.0.1.1 --nqn=test-nvme
nvme connect -T 0 -t rdma -a 10.0.1.1 -n test_nvme

---
 fabrics.c | 33 ++++++++++++++++++++++++---------
 1 file changed, 24 insertions(+), 9 deletions(-)

diff --git a/fabrics.c b/fabrics.c
index 333669f..f952722 100644
--- a/fabrics.c
+++ b/fabrics.c
@@ -60,6 +60,7 @@ static struct config {
 	int  keep_alive_tmo;
 	int  reconnect_delay;
 	int  ctrl_loss_tmo;
+	int  tos;
 	char *raw;
 	char *device;
 	int  duplicate_connect;
@@ -576,11 +577,12 @@ add_bool_argument(char **argstr, int *max_len, char *arg_str, bool arg)
 }
 
 static int
-add_int_argument(char **argstr, int *max_len, char *arg_str, int arg)
+add_int_argument(char **argstr, int *max_len, char *arg_str, int arg,
+		 bool allow_zero)
 {
 	int len;
 
-	if (arg) {
+	if ((arg && !allow_zero) || (arg != -1 && allow_zero)) {
 		len = snprintf(*argstr, *max_len, ",%s=%d", arg_str, arg);
 		if (len < 0)
 			return -EINVAL;
@@ -640,21 +642,23 @@ static int build_options(char *argstr, int max_len, bool discover)
 		    add_argument(&argstr, &max_len, "hostid", cfg.hostid)) ||
 	    (!discover &&
 	      add_int_argument(&argstr, &max_len, "nr_io_queues",
-				cfg.nr_io_queues)) ||
+				cfg.nr_io_queues, false)) ||
 	    add_int_argument(&argstr, &max_len, "nr_write_queues",
-				cfg.nr_write_queues) ||
+				cfg.nr_write_queues, false) ||
 	    add_int_argument(&argstr, &max_len, "nr_poll_queues",
-				cfg.nr_poll_queues) ||
+				cfg.nr_poll_queues, false) ||
 	    (!discover &&
 	      add_int_argument(&argstr, &max_len, "queue_size",
-				cfg.queue_size)) ||
+				cfg.queue_size, false)) ||
 	    (!discover &&
 	      add_int_argument(&argstr, &max_len, "keep_alive_tmo",
-				cfg.keep_alive_tmo)) ||
+				cfg.keep_alive_tmo, false)) ||
 	    add_int_argument(&argstr, &max_len, "reconnect_delay",
-				cfg.reconnect_delay) ||
+				cfg.reconnect_delay, false) ||
 	    add_int_argument(&argstr, &max_len, "ctrl_loss_tmo",
-				cfg.ctrl_loss_tmo) ||
+				cfg.ctrl_loss_tmo, false) ||
+	    add_int_argument(&argstr, &max_len, "tos",
+				cfg.tos, true) ||
 	    add_bool_argument(&argstr, &max_len, "duplicate_connect",
 				cfg.duplicate_connect) ||
 	    add_bool_argument(&argstr, &max_len, "disable_sqflow",
@@ -749,6 +753,13 @@ retry:
 		p += len;
 	}
 
+	if (cfg.tos != -1) {
+		len = sprintf(p, ",tos=%d", cfg.tos);
+		if (len < 0)
+			return -EINVAL;
+		p += len;
+	}
+
 	if (cfg.keep_alive_tmo && !discover) {
 		len = sprintf(p, ",keep_alive_tmo=%d", cfg.keep_alive_tmo);
 		if (len < 0)
@@ -1065,6 +1076,7 @@ int discover(const char *desc, int argc, char **argv, bool connect)
 		{"keep-alive-tmo",  'k', "LIST", CFG_INT, &cfg.keep_alive_tmo,  required_argument, "keep alive timeout period in seconds" },
 		{"reconnect-delay", 'c', "LIST", CFG_INT, &cfg.reconnect_delay, required_argument, "reconnect timeout period in seconds" },
 		{"ctrl-loss-tmo",   'l', "LIST", CFG_INT, &cfg.ctrl_loss_tmo,   required_argument, "controller loss timeout period in seconds" },
+		{"tos",             'T', "LIST", CFG_INT, &cfg.tos,             required_argument, "type of service" },
 		{"hdr_digest", 'g', "", CFG_NONE, &cfg.hdr_digest, no_argument, "enable transport protocol header digest (TCP transport)" },
 		{"data_digest", 'G', "", CFG_NONE, &cfg.data_digest, no_argument, "enable transport protocol data digest (TCP transport)" },
 		{"nr-io-queues",    'i', "LIST", CFG_INT, &cfg.nr_io_queues,    required_argument, "number of io queues to use (default is core count)" },
@@ -1076,6 +1088,7 @@ int discover(const char *desc, int argc, char **argv, bool connect)
 		{NULL},
 	};
 
+	cfg.tos = -1;
 	ret = argconfig_parse(argc, argv, desc, command_line_options, &cfg,
 			sizeof(cfg));
 	if (ret)
@@ -1122,6 +1135,7 @@ int connect(const char *desc, int argc, char **argv)
 		{"keep-alive-tmo",  'k', "LIST", CFG_INT, &cfg.keep_alive_tmo,  required_argument, "keep alive timeout period in seconds" },
 		{"reconnect-delay", 'c', "LIST", CFG_INT, &cfg.reconnect_delay, required_argument, "reconnect timeout period in seconds" },
 		{"ctrl-loss-tmo",   'l', "LIST", CFG_INT, &cfg.ctrl_loss_tmo,   required_argument, "controller loss timeout period in seconds" },
+		{"tos",             'T', "LIST", CFG_INT, &cfg.tos,             required_argument, "type of service" },
 		{"duplicate_connect", 'D', "", CFG_NONE, &cfg.duplicate_connect, no_argument, "allow duplicate connections between same transport host and subsystem port" },
 		{"disable_sqflow", 'd', "", CFG_NONE, &cfg.disable_sqflow, no_argument, "disable controller sq flow control (default false)" },
 		{"hdr_digest", 'g', "", CFG_NONE, &cfg.hdr_digest, no_argument, "enable transport protocol header digest (TCP transport)" },
@@ -1129,6 +1143,7 @@ int connect(const char *desc, int argc, char **argv)
 		{NULL},
 	};
 
+	cfg.tos = -1;
 	ret = argconfig_parse(argc, argv, desc, command_line_options, &cfg,
 			sizeof(cfg));
 	if (ret)
